There was some interest in my shelving system with LEDs for which I custom wrote
some software, so I took a really quick video to show it off. You can watch that
video here:

https://youtu.be/kpmAs9pOU7s

I talk about my inspiration for this being the software I wrote to synchronize
Christmas lights to music. Here are a couple of my light show videos.

https://youtu.be/2Ql0Xz_81y0

https://youtu.be/TqOleIBh6fQ

If there is anymore interest in the specifics, I may do a second video.

In Off Topic, 1001bricks writes:
  In Off Topic, macebobo writes:
  There was some interest in my shelving system with LEDs for which I custom wrote
some software, so I took a really quick video to show it off. You can watch that
video here:

https://youtu.be/kpmAs9pOU7s

You must be a fan of hackaday? - I am!!!


Yes

  
I've found a far more economical system; it says "pick at A01-05", so you
go to columns "A", find the "01" one (the first, obviously), and pick in the
"05" (fifth) drawer.
There's a sticker on it showing "A01-05".

Mine have a sticker on front as well. e.g. 04-10-5 is shelf 4, row 10, bin 5.
Zero prefaced for simple sorting.

  
No LED, no wire, no power.

I had everything left over from my Christmas lighting days, only time was spent,
which has been paid back and now pays dividends.

  
In short, what you did is a very nice system for sure, but IMHO here, a bit overkill
and not really optimal for production

I'm a data driven guy. Comparing orders of similar size:

Without the system: 240 parts in 70 lots - 55 minutes
With the system: 232 parts in 71 lots - 42 minutes.

I can do a 10 lot, 30 to 100 part order in about 3 minutes, from order received
to packed and ready to ship.

Plus the software makes it so that I can copy/paste my shipping info right into
pirate ship. Also, the software can find bins that are not quite full, add stock
by element id, upload brickstore files, part out sets, get notifications, and
more!

Soon, I will have a proper sales history and be able to do some cool analytics
that I can't do on BL.

  
But, again, sincere congratulations!

Thanks!
